4. Setup Instructions

Follow these steps to set up your ALPOWL Podcast Equipment Bundle.

  1. Assemble Microphone Stands: Securely attach the adjustable suspension scissor arm stands to your desk or desired surface.
  2. Mount Microphones: Attach the shock mounts to the microphone stands. Carefully place the BM-800 condenser microphones into the shock mounts.
  3. Attach Pop Filters and Foam Caps: Install the double-layer pop filters in front of the microphones and place the anti-wind foam caps over the microphone heads.
  4. Connect Microphones to Mixer: Use the provided XLR to 3.5mm cables to connect each BM-800 microphone to the "Condenser mic 1 IN" and "Condenser mic 2 IN" ports on the ALPOWL mixer.
  5. Connect Headphones/Speakers: Plug your earphones into the "Headset IN/OUT" port or "Monitor OUT" port on the mixer.
  6. Connect to Device (PC/Smartphone):
    • For PC/Laptop: Connect the mixer to your computer using the USB-C to USB-A data cable. The mixer will be recognized as an audio device.
    • For Smartphone/Tablet: Use the 3.5mm audio cables to connect the "LIVE1 IN/OUT" or "LIVE2 IN/OUT" ports on the mixer to your smartphone's headphone jack (an adapter may be required for phones without a 3.5mm jack).
  7. Connect Accompaniment (Optional): If using external accompaniment, connect your device to the "Accompany IN" port using a 3.5mm audio cable.
  8. Power On: Connect the USB power cable to the mixer and a power source. Press the power button on the mixer.

5. Operating Instructions

5.1. Basic Audio Control

  • Microphone Volume: Use the "MIC+" and "MIC-" knobs to adjust the input volume of your microphones. Observe the colorful volume indicators for optimal levels.
  • Accompaniment Volume: Adjust the "Accompany+" and "Accompany-" knobs to control the volume of any background music or external audio input.
  • Monitor Volume: The "Monitor+" and "Monitor-" knobs control the volume in your connected headphones or monitoring speakers.
  • Recording Volume: Use the "Record+" and "Record-" knobs to set the output volume for your recording software or live stream.
  • Treble/Bass Adjustment: Fine-tune your microphone's sound profile using the "Treble+" and "Bass+" knobs.
  • Echo Effect: Add or reduce echo using the "Echo+" and "Echo-" knobs.

5.2. Sound Effects and Voice Changes

  • Pre-set Sound Effects: Press any of the 10 sound effect buttons (e.g., "Cheer", "Din", "Kiss") to trigger instant audio cues during your broadcast or recording.
  • Electric Tones: Use the "1 click switch electric tones" button to cycle through various electronic voice effects.
  • Voice Changes: Select from four distinct voice modulation options:
    • Cute and sweet female voice
    • Vigorous and deep male voice
    • Adorable and tender child voice
    • Rough and abrasive magic voice
Image showing the ALPOWL mixer's sound effect buttons and voice change options

Figure 7: Mixer Sound Effects and Voice Change Controls.

This image provides a detailed view of the sound effect buttons and voice change options available on the ALPOWL V8S2 mixer. It visually represents the "3 colourful volume indicators," "10 kinds of sound effects buttons," and the "1 click switch electric tones" feature. The four voice change options are also depicted with corresponding icons.

5.3. Advanced Features

  • One-Click Original Sound Elimination: Press the designated button to remove the original vocals from a track, allowing for karaoke or instrumental covers.
  • Voice Over (Ducking): When enabled, this feature automatically lowers the volume of background music when you speak into the microphone and restores it when you stop.
  • One-Key Mute: Use the mute button to quickly silence your microphone input.

9.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your equipment, refer to the following common problems and solutions.

  1. No Sound Output:
    • Ensure all cables are securely connected.
    • Check if the mixer is powered on.
    • Verify that microphone and monitor volumes are turned up on the mixer.
    • Confirm the mixer is selected as the input/output device in your computer's sound settings or streaming software.
    • Test with different headphones or speakers.
  2. Microphone Not Picking Up Sound:
    • Ensure the microphone cable is fully inserted into the correct input port on the mixer.
    • Increase the "MIC+" volume knob on the mixer.
    • Check if the microphone is muted.
    • Ensure the microphone is facing the sound source correctly (cardioid pattern).
  3. Distorted Audio:
    • Reduce the "MIC+" volume knob to prevent clipping.
    • Check for loose cable connections.
    • Ensure the recording software input level is not too high.
  4. Echo/Feedback:
    • Reduce the "Echo+" knob if unwanted echo is present.
    • Ensure speakers are not too close to microphones, causing feedback. Use headphones for monitoring.
